Mayor Nirenberg spoke at the event: 'Words cannot do justice to the loss of a child or family member, but please know that I and the rest of San Antonio, Military City USA, will never forget your sons, your daughters, your family members...'

Matthew Hester, 10, holds a program next to Rosa Hester during a ceremony for Gold Star Mothers and Families at Joint Base San Antonio-Fort Sam Houston on Sunday. SAN ANTONIO — For the first time since 2019, Joint Base San Antonio-Fort Sam Houston organized an in-person ceremony Sunday for National Gold Star Mothers and Families Day, inviting families who lost loved ones in service with the armed forces.

Carla Sizer, a Gold Star mother, drew tears while speaking of her son, Spc. Dane R. Balcon, who was 19 when he was killed in Iraq in 2007. That was 15 years ago but the grief is enduring, Sizer said, and is especially acute in September, the month when she drove onto her street and saw the “white van and two Army soldiers standing in my driveway.”Larina Williams holds her daughter, Ava, during a ceremony for Gold Star Mothers and Families at Joint Base San Antonio-Fort Sam Houston on Sunday.

Mary Rose and Ronald Johnson, parents of Benjamin Franklin Johnson, who died in Frieberg, Germany in 1997 at 21, were there to honor their son, too. They host a monthly local support group with Tragedy Assistance Program for Survivors to help comfort others who have been through loss.
